Pick up your free tree! In partnership with local community organizations, New York Restoration Project is giving away trees throughout NYC this fall.
To pick up your free tree, you must agree to:
- plant in one of the five boroughs.
- keep trees properly watered and maintained.
- plant your tree in the ground of your yard and NOT along streets, in city parks, in containers, terraces, balconies or on roofs.
Registration will be posted no earlier than three weeks before a giveaway date. If registration is closed, a limited quantity of trees will be available on a first come, first served basis.

Maintaining a quality lawn area involves more than irrigation, fertilization and pesticide applications. Healthy grass demands proper mowing techniques, occasional dethatching, and aeration. Knowing when and how to apply these practices will lead to a dense, vigorous grassy area.
